Education Stochastic Oscillator - Technical Analysis from A to Z
The Stochastic Oscillator compares where a security's price closed relative to its price range over a given time period. The Stochastic Oscillator is displayed as two lines. The main line is called "%K." The second line, called "%D," is a moving average of %K. The %K line is usually displayed as a solid line, and the %D line is usually displayed as a dotted line.
